Your chain reminded me of my setup when I played in my old band The Fabulous Lounge Punks:

Gibson Les Paul Studio into...

Boss SD-1 Super Overdrive
Boss DS-1 Distortion
MXR Distortion +
Danelectro Daddy-O Overdrive
Electro-Harmonix Big Muff Pi
Boss DM-3 Delay
Boss TR-2 Tremolo
Boss PH-2 Super Phaser
Boss BF-2 Flanger
Crybaby Wah
Danelectro Dan Echo

...into a '74 Fender Twin.

I ran the Twin clean and used different distortions or overdrives for different songs.

I have:

NYC Big Muff (very nice, I use it a lot)
Boss DD-somethingorother delay pedal (not used much, bit too digital for me)
Boss CE-20 Chorus pedal (I use this a bit too much really, clean guitar doesn't sound right to me without a bit of chorus, though I have been using the reverb on my amp a bit more lately)
POD 2.0 (only occasionaly used, IMO there is one usable distortion sound and one or two interesting effects on it like the tremolo and the swell)
